Lavender Milk Tea

Ingredients

  • 2 tbsp dried culinary lavender
  • 2 cups water
  • 2 cups milk (any kind)
  • Honey or sugar (to taste)
  • Vanilla extract (optional)

Instructions

  1. Boil water in a pot or kettle. Once boiling, add dried lavender, remove from heat, cover, and steep for 5 minutes.
  2. Strain the lavender infusion into a pitcher while gently heating the milk until steaming but not boiling.
  3. Pour warm milk into the pitcher with the infused lavender tea. Add honey or sugar to sweeten as desired, along with vanilla extract if using.
  4. Serve immediately in cups or cool for an iced version over ice in tall glasses.
